NAME
SPI_register_trigger_data - make ephemeral trigger data available in SPI queries
SYNOPSIS
int SPI_register_trigger_data(TriggerData *tdata)
DESCRIPTION
SPI_register_trigger_data makes any ephemeral relations captured by a trigger available to queries planned and executed through the current SPI connection. Currently, this means the transition tables captured by an AFTER trigger defined with a REFERENCING OLD/NEW TABLE AS ... clause. This function should be called by a PL trigger handler function after connecting.
ARGUMENTS
TriggerData *tdata
the TriggerData object passed to a trigger handler
function as fcinfo->context
RETURN VALUE
If the execution of the command was successful then the following (nonnegative) value will be returned:
SPI_OK_TD_REGISTER
if the captured trigger data (if any) has been
successfully registered
On error, one of the following negative values is returned:
SPI_ERROR_ARGUMENT
if tdata is NULL
SPI_ERROR_UNCONNECTED
if called from an unconnected C function
SPI_ERROR_REL_DUPLICATE
if the name of any trigger data transient relation is
already registered for this connection
